XRP, associated with Ripple Labs, remains one of the most controversial and influential cryptocurrencies in the market. Despite the legal battles it has faced with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), XRP has demonstrated strong resilience and has managed to maintain its position among the top ten cryptocurrencies by market capitalization.

Technically, XRP is currently trading between a strong support level near $0.45 and key resistance at $0.60. A clear breakout above resistance could open the door for a new upward wave towards levels of $0.75 - $0.85, especially if this is associated with positive news regarding the legal case or new banking partnerships.

From a fundamental perspective, the strength of XRP lies in the fact that it is not just a speculative currency, but part of an international payment and money transfer system targeting banks and financial institutions. If Ripple can expand its global network through the ODL (On-Demand Liquidity) system, the actual value of XRP could exceed its current price significantly.

Other factors that may drive the increase include a definitive resolution of the case with the SEC in favor of Ripple, the active reinstatement of XRP on major trading platforms like Coinbase, and an increase in institutional adoption.

However, on the flip side, it is important to note that the market is volatile, and any legal delays or strict regulatory legislation could negatively impact performance.
